#28 - Grace at Work
In this Rewind episode, Pastor Brandon and Pastor Joel talk through Sunday’s message, “Divine Grace in the Daily Grind,” and how the gospel transforms the way we see our work—whether you’re in a shop, an office, a classroom, or full-time ministry.
They unpack the idea that our label comes before our labor: who we are in Christ matters more than what we do for a living. From there, they dig into some honest questions:
How do I know when work has become an idol?
What does it look like to avoid both workaholism and laziness?
Can I really serve Jesus in a job I don’t love?
How should the gospel shape my attitude toward my boss, coworkers, and employees?
You’ll also hear them reflect on how Christianity has historically shaped society through ordinary believers living out their faith in everyday vocations—and why your workplace today is one of your biggest mission fields.
